We are currently seeking a dedicated and enthusiastic Student Recruitment Consultant to join our dynamic team. This is an exciting opportunity for a motivated individual who is passionate about providing exceptional support to students and helping them excel in their academic pursuits.

Responsibilities:

  • Assist students with enquiries related to their academic programmes, extracurricular activities, and other aspects of student life.
  • Calling all prospective students who have enquired.
  • Ensuring you are hitting KPI's and Targets set.
  • Coordinate and manage appointments, meetings, and events for students.
  • Provide guidance on navigating the university system, resources, and policies.
  • Offer support with time management, study skills, and stress management techniques.
  • Maintain detailed records of student interactions and progress.
  • Collaborate with other team members to ensure seamless service delivery.
  • Stay up-to-date with the latest trends and best practices in student support services.

Requirements:

  • Experience within a sales role.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to interact effectively with diverse groups of people.
  • Strong sales experience.
  • Excellent organisational and time management skills, with the ability to multitask and prioritise workload.
  • A genuine interest and passion for helping others.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and other relevant software.
